Special Symbols and Features

Chain Reaction

Symbols forming wins disappear, making way for new symbols to drop in that may form new wins.

Empire Expand

Each reel has 6 symbol positions, but only the bottom 3 rows are active at the start of each spin. Forming a win activates the next inactive row from bottom to top for the following chain reactions, increasing the number of possible win ways. At the start of each spin the active rows are reset to the initial 3.

Wild

Wilds substitute for all paying symbols. Wilds, including those unlocked by completing a stage in the Emperor’s Rule, appear on reel 3 until the last stage of the Emperor’s Rule is completed, and on reels 3 and 4 after that.

Emperor’s Rule

A progress bar with 4 stages is placed over the 6th reel. Landing the highest paying symbol (Precious Gem) on the active rows fills the progress bar. Landing 100 symbols is required to complete each stage of the progress.

Completing each stage of the Emperor’s Rule adds new symbol types and features to the reels as follows:

Stage 1: Emperor Wild (Purple)

Stage 2: High Emperor Wild (Green)

Stage 3: Great Emperor Wild (Pink)

Stage 4: Free Spins

After stage 4 of the Emperor’s Rule is completed, the progress bar is removed and the 6th reel is unlocked.

Emperor Wild

The Emperor Wild expands over all active rows on a reel. It does not disappear after taking part in a win until all 6 rows of the reels are activated. The Emperor Wild counts for as many symbols as the current number of active rows when it participates in a winning combination.

High Emperor Wild

The High Emperor Wild acts the same as the Emperor Wild, but also holds a random win multiplier of between x2, x3, x5, or x10. The multiplier is applied to all wins in which the High Emperor Wild participates.

Great Emperor Wild

The Great Emperor Wild acts the same as the High Emperor Wild and disappears after taking part in up to 3 consecutive wins after all 6 rows of the reels are activated.

Free Spins

Free Spins scatters are added to reels 1, 2, 5, and 6 after completing the last stage of the Emperor’s Rule. Landing 4 Free Spins scatters in a spin triggers 10 Free Spins. Landing 4 Free Spins symbols in Free Spins awards 10 additional spins.

Free Spins are played with all 6 rows activated.

Max Potential Win

The maximum potential win amount is limited to 20,000x your current stake. If the total win of a game round reaches 20,000x the round immediately ends, the maximum potential win is awarded, and any remaining Free Spins are forfeited.

How to Play Emperor of India

Game Progress

Any progress features in the game, including symbols locked onto the reels which affect subsequent spins, are saved for your game at the stake level you are playing at.
You can have different progress levels at different stakes on the same game, and move between them by changing the stake.
If you are awarded free spins from a promotional campaign any progress in the main game including any locked symbols, will be saved and be available to continue playing at the same stake once the free spins have been completed.
Please note that this stateful game saves its state forever.
